10 Healthy Chicken Marinade Ideas {Low Calorie + High Protein} Recipe

Discover 10 healthy and flavorful chicken marinade ideas that are low in calories and high in protein. These easy-to-make marinades use wholesome ingredients like olive oil, fresh herbs, citrus, Greek yogurt, and spices, perfect for enhancing the taste and tenderness of chicken breasts or thighs. Ideal for meal prep or a quick weeknight dinner, these marinades can be stored in the fridge or freezer, offering versatile options to keep your meals exciting and nutritious.

Ingredients

Basic Ingredients for Chicken

  • 11.5 pounds raw chicken breasts or thighs

Marinade 1: Honey Garlic Soy

  • 4 tablespoons honey
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ons reduced-sodium so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ons water

Marinade 2: Cilantro Lime

  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
  • 1 garlic clove, minced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
  • 2 teaspoons honey
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Marinade 3: Spiced Maple Lime

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
  • 2 tablespoons maple syrup or honey
  • 2 teaspoons gar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on ground allspice
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per

Marinade 4: Yogurt Curry

  • 1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on curry powder
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 2 teaspoons honey
  • 1 teaspoon salt

Marinade 5: Chili Garlic Soy

  • 3 tablespoons chili garlic sauce
  • 3 tablespoons reduced-sodium so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il

Marinade 6: Lemon Ginger Soy

  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1/4 cup lemon juice
  • 1/4 cup reduced-sodium so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ons finely grated fresh ginger
  • 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es
  • Dash of salt and pepper

Marinade 7: Pesto Balsamic

  • 1/2 cup pesto (homemade or store-bought)
  • 2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Marinade 8: Mediterranean Lemon Herb

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 3 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ons dried oregano
  • 1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per

Marinade 9: Chili Lime Spice

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• Juice of one lime
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on cumin
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per

Marinade 10: BBQ Garlic

  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 1/4 cup barbecue sauce (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1/2 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Chicken: Place 1 to 1.5 pounds of raw chicken breasts or thighs into a large ziplock bag, bowl, or container suitable for marinating.
  2. Make the Marinade: In a small bowl or jar, combine the ingredients for your chosen marinade. Mix well until all components are fully incorporated.
  3. Marinate the Chicken: Pour the prepared marinade over the chicken. Toss or massage the chicken to ensure it is well coated with the marinade.
  4. Refrigerate: Allow the chicken to marinate for at least 30 minutes to let the flavors develop. For best results, marinate for several hours or up to 24-48 hours in the refrigerator.
  5. Freezing Option: If desired, the marinated chicken can be stored in the freezer for up to 3 months. Defrost thoroughly before cooking using your preferred method.

Notes

  • Use either chicken breasts or thighs depending on your preference; both work well with these marinades.
  • Marinating times can vary; longer marinating enhances flavor and tenderness.
  • When using yogurt-based or acidic marinades, avoid marinating chicken for more than 24 hours to prevent texture breakdown.
  • All marinades can be prepared in advance and stored in the fridge in an airtight container.
  • Cook chicken thoroughly after marinating to an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) for safety.
